How to choose abdominal and torso support

A binder-style support is usually chosen for broad, adjustable pressure around the midsection, while lumbar, maternity, and sacroiliac braces add more targeted structure. The right route depends on whether you need a soft wrap feeling, firm low-back control, pregnancy belly support, or pelvic stability during everyday movement.

Use this comparison to separate binder-style coverage from more targeted brace choices.

Choice Best context Main advantage When to choose differently
Binder-style wrap Broad torso coverage and simple adjustability Easy to position and usually lower profile Choose a lumbar brace when low-back structure matters more.
Lumbar brace Lower-back support during upright routines More shaped support than a general wrap Choose a soft wrap when abdominal coverage is the main goal.
Maternity support Pregnancy belly and low-back comfort Fit is designed around a changing body shape Choose a standard brace for non-maternity use.
SI support Pelvic and sacroiliac stability Focuses support below the waistline Choose lumbar or binder-style support for higher torso coverage.

Fit, use, and safety guidance

  • Measure around the area where the support will sit, following the product sizing guide.
  • Choose a brace height that matches your torso length so sitting remains comfortable.
  • Start with a snug fit that still allows steady breathing and normal movement.
  • Wear over a thin layer if your skin is sensitive to seams or edges.
  • Recheck placement after walking or sitting, since wrap tension can shift with movement.

When to check with a clinician first

Speak with a qualified clinician before choosing abdominal or back support if you have recent surgery, unexplained swelling, new numbness, changing bowel or bladder symptoms, significant trauma, pregnancy concerns, or pain that is worsening. A professional can help confirm which support style is appropriate for your situation.

Is an abdominal binder the same as a back brace?

No. A binder usually wraps broadly around the torso, while a back brace is shaped for lumbar or pelvic support. Some shoppers compare both because the wear area can overlap.
